Here is a pic of an old kerosene lantern a friend and I found a few years back while on a ghost town hunting trip. It was down in Nevada in the Santa Rosa mountian range. We had stopped along a trail for a bite to eat. We did a little exploring around the area, and about seventy five yards away near a ridge we found a small miners shack. The lanten was hanging on a nail inside. It was very interesting looking around. There were picks, gold pans, a bunk, table, canned goods, etc. It looked like the miner just left one day and never came back. We figure that was about the late 1930's. Some day I may revisit the place.
